Uconnect & Sprint/ Help Needed

Frustration is the only way to describe issues I've had with my factory Uconnect. I'm a Sprint PCS subscriber (if that's important) and can't seem to find a bluetooth phone that functions as it should. The most recent phone I purchased (LG-LX350) seems to work, yet whenever I make a call, I get a verbal message that my signal strength & battery life are low. With other bluetooth phones I've used, the signal strength meters never functioned yet I wouldn't receive this message audibly. Does anyone on the forum have Sprint and receive meter readings. All other bluetooth phones have either been incompatible or would give much difficulty with other functions ie: call waiting or simply losing the bluetooth connection all together. Advice please!!

I have T-Mobile and use a Motorola v330 phone with Bluetooth and it works nearly flawlessly. I get audible and visual readings for the signal strength but nothing for the battery.

My guess is that your issue is with the phones you've tried and not with the UConnect or Verizon.
